Types of Guns in Modern Warfare 3
Modern Warfare 3 categorizes its weapons into several classes, each suited for different combat scenarios. These classes include assault rifles, submachine guns, light machine guns, shotguns, sniper rifles, pistols, and launchers. Each category has its own set of advantages and disadvantages, requiring players to weigh their options carefully when selecting a weapon.
Assault Rifles
Assault rifles are the backbone of Modern Warfare 3's arsenal, offering a balanced combination of accuracy, damage, and fire rate. Popular choices in this category include the FAD, M4, and Type 95. These weapons are versatile, performing well in both medium and long-range engagements. However, they may struggle in close-quarters combat due to their slower handling and reload times.

Submachine Guns
Submachine guns excel in close-quarters combat, providing players with rapid fire rates and quick handling. Weapons like the PP2000 and MP7 are favorites among players who prefer fast-paced, aggressive playstyles. While they lack the range and accuracy of assault rifles, their high damage output at close range makes them formidable in the right hands.
Light Machine Guns
Light machine guns offer unmatched sustained fire capabilities, making them ideal for suppressing enemies in prolonged engagements. The RPD and PKM are prime examples of this category, capable of delivering devastating damage over time. However, their bulkiness and slow movement speed can make them less effective in fast-paced scenarios.

The Best Gun in Modern Warfare 3
When it comes to the best gun in Modern Warfare 3, opinions vary depending on individual preferences and playstyles. However, one weapon that consistently ranks among the top choices is the FAD. The FAD, or Future Assault Rifle, is a versatile assault rifle that strikes an excellent balance between accuracy, damage, and fire rate. Its lightweight design allows for quick movement, making it suitable for both close and medium-range engagements.
One of the FAD's standout features is its stability under fire, enabling players to maintain accuracy even during extended bursts. This attribute makes it particularly effective in high-pressure situations where precision is crucial. Additionally, the FAD benefits from a wide range of attachments, allowing players to customize it to suit their needs. Whether you prefer a red dot sight for close-quarters combat or a variable zoom scope for longer engagements, the FAD can be adapted to meet virtually any requirement.
Another contender for the best gun in Modern Warfare 3 is the M4. Known for its reliability and ease of use, the M4 is a favorite among players who prioritize consistency over raw power. Its moderate damage output and balanced attributes make it a solid choice for beginners and veterans alike. While it may not excel in any single area, its versatility ensures that it remains a strong performer across a variety of scenarios.

What Are the Best Perks?
Perks in Modern Warfare 3 offer players additional abilities and advantages that can significantly enhance their gameplay. Choosing the right perks can make all the difference, especially when combined with the best gun in Modern Warfare 3. Some of the most popular perks include Sleight of Hand, Marathon, and Lightweight.
Sleight of Hand reduces reload times, allowing players to stay in the fight longer and maintain pressure on their opponents. Marathon increases sprint duration, enabling players to cover more ground quickly and respond to threats more effectively. Lightweight enhances movement speed, providing players with a crucial edge in close-quarters combat.
When selecting perks, it's essential to consider how they complement your chosen weapon and playstyle. For instance, players using submachine guns or shotguns might benefit more from Lightweight and Marathon, while those favoring sniper rifles or assault rifles might prefer Sleight of Hand and Scavenger.
How Can Perks Enhance Gameplay?
Perks can elevate your gameplay experience by addressing specific weaknesses or enhancing existing strengths. For example, the Hardline perk reduces the requirement for killstreak rewards, allowing players to unlock powerful abilities more quickly. This can be particularly useful in high-stakes situations where maintaining momentum is crucial.
Similarly, perks like Ghost can help players avoid detection by enemy UAVs and air support, increasing their chances of survival in heavily contested areas. By carefully selecting and combining perks, players can create a synergistic effect that amplifies their overall effectiveness in the game.
